Forwarding Contact Groups (Distribution Lists) Outlook 2013

WebI've received a contact group (email address list) via email that was sent as an outlook contact, and is a .msg file. How can I save it as a contact group in outlook ? This seems absurdly simple, but save - as wants to save on the computer, and no offering is made to save as a contact group entry in the contacts. WebApr 15, 2016 · As stated above, when forwarding the Outlook contact group from a 365 account, the attachment is a link to the object in 365, and doesn't contain the actual list of contacts in the group. This is why the attachment appears blank when viewed by someone outside the same 365 domain (it's a link to an object they can't see).

WebSep 13, 2024 · Open the Contact Group (Distribution List in older versions) Outlook 2010 and up: Click Forward Group Outlook 2007 and older: Click on the Send button to expand the menu. Select In Internet Format … Webattachment. Follow these steps to e-mail your contact groups to another person. 1. Open your contact group from within your Outlook contacts/people. Click on the “Forward Group” button, and choose “As an Outlook Contact”. 2. Outlook creates an e-mail message and turns the contact group into an attachment. Address the e-mail

WebApr 11, 2016 · As stated above, when forwarding the Outlook contact group from a 365 account, the attachment is a link to the object in 365, and doesn't contain the actual list of contacts in the group. This is why the attachment appears blank when viewed by someone outside the same 365 domain (it's a link to an object they can't see).
